Perform a series of exercises designed to enhance your flexibility, bolster your core muscles, and promote optimal spinal health. Active participation on a regular basis can alleviate back pain and prevent recurrences.
Maintain proper posture when walking, standing, and reclining. By correcting your posture, you can minimize the strain on your back and the likelihood that you will develop chronic discomfort.
Ensure that your daily environment and workspace are ergonomically sound. Supportive mattresses, adjustable chairs, and ideal desk height all contribute to a spine-friendly lifestyle.
Implement Cold and Heat Therapy
To alleviate muscle tension and reduce inflammation, alternate between cold and heated compresses. Urgent relief can be obtained with this straightforward and economical approach.
Integrate meditative practices such as deep breathing and meditation into your routine. Effective stress management is essential, given that stress can worsen back discomfort.
Dehydration has the potential to impact the intervertebral discs located in the vertebrae. Adhere to a sufficient water intake on a daily basis in order to preserve disc hydration and overall spinal health.
Invest in pillows and a supportive mattress. Ensure a restorative sleep environment by maintaining a pleasant sleeping position that properly aligns the spine. Stretching should be incorporated into your daily regimen. Concentrate on back, hamstring, and hip flexion stretches in order to increase flexibility and relieve tension.
An excess of weight may cause back strain. Reduce the strain on your spine by achieving and maintaining a healthy weight through the use of a well-balanced diet and consistent exercise.
A physical therapist can provide recommendations on individualized exercises and techniques. They are capable of resolving particular concerns, enhancing physical mobility, and devising individualized approaches to alleviate back discomfort.

Avoid resting for extended periods of time. It is especially important to stand, stretch, and move frequently if you have a sedentary occupation. Physical activity is vital for spinal health.
Consider chiropractic care or acupuncture as treatments. Alternative treatments that emphasize holistic well-being seem to provide alleviation for some individuals.
Obtain medical attention if your back pain continues to worsen or persists. Prompt intervention can avert the onset of chronic conditions and guarantee appropriate treatment.

Bid Farewell to Muscle Pain
Muscle pain, which can arise from various sources including strenuous exercise routines, improper ergonomics, or more serious conditions, can substantially impede routine tasks. It is critical to discover efficacious methods for mitigating and averting muscle discomfort in order to sustain an active and pain-free way of life.
This guide aims to examine evidence-based strategies that can assist you in alleviating muscle discomfort and achieving a more resilient and comfortable body.
Determine the Cause
Ascertain the origin of the muscular discomfort. It is imperative to ascertain the underlying cause, be it overexertion, poor posture, or a medical condition, in order to administer targeted treatment.
Allow adequate rest and recovery time for the afflicted muscles. By avoiding overtraining, you will allow your body to naturally recover.
For acute muscle injuries, apply cold packs to reduce inflammation; for chronic muscle tension, apply heat packs to enhance blood circulation and induce relaxation.
Foam rollers or routine massages can be utilized to perform self-myofascial release techniques, which serve to mitigate muscle tension and enhance overall range of motion.
Dehydration is a potential cause of muscle cramping. It is crucial to maintain proper hydration, particularly while engaging in physical activity, in order to promote strong muscles.
Stretching should be incorporated into your routine. Concentrate on the main muscle groups in order to reduce muscle stiffness and increase flexibility.

Incorporate essential nutrients such as magnesium, potassium, and calcium into a well-balanced diet. These minerals are vital for the recovery and function of muscles.
Muscle tension is elevated by stress. To facilitate relaxation, integrate stress-management strategies such as deep breathing or meditation.
Consider applying topical analgesics or pain-relieving lotions available over-the-counter. These may offer localized muscle soreness relief.
Progression of Gradual Exercises
When resuming physical activity following an extended period of inactivity, start slowly. Acute, strenuous exercise regimens may induce muscle strain and discomfort.
Ensure that you obtain an adequate amount of high-quality slumber. Sleep is essential for overall health and muscle recovery.
Physical therapy should be consulted regarding persistent or recurring muscle discomfort. By analyzing your movement patterns, they are capable of devising individualized exercises that target muscle imbalances.
Incorporate into your diet anti-inflammatory nutrients such as fatty fish, berries, and leafy greens. These nutrients may aid in muscle recovery and inflammation reduction.

Preventive measures
Before engaging in strenuous physical activity, you should always warm up to prepare your musculature.
Consistently incorporate flexibility exercises and strength training into your exercise regimen.
To prevent muscle strain, ensure that your workspace and daily activities are ergonomically designed.
Utilize techniques for stress management to decrease muscle tension.
It is imperative that individuals experiencing chronic or severe muscle discomfort seek the advice of a healthcare professional in order to obtain an accurate diagnosis and direction regarding the most suitable course of treatment.
